Quote: | OK, so if someone has some dropshipped items listed does it effect the rest of the store that aren't fropshipped items? Should a seller have a seperate store for dropshipped items? |
It's not all droppshippers. Mainly the ones that FLOOD the market.
Quote: | How does froogle ecrater know which items are from dropshippers? Im sure they have more to do with their time. My photos i upload are renamed |
Ecrater.com uses a crawler to do this. Anyone can see that your photos are the exact same as a zillion other sellers that tells them that you are using a stock photo from the drop shipper. NOW if you buy the product and take your own pics - that's different. You aren't using a drop shipper if you own the product. It's still an affiliate but it's harder to detect if you use you own images. |
